Coloring tips: How to color Dinosaur Learning ABC coloring page well?
Start with the dinosaur's body and choose a fun, bright color like green, teal, or purple. Dinosaurs don't have to be realistic, so kids can let their imagination run wild. Use a slightly darker shade to add simple shading along the belly and under the arms to give the dinosaur a rounded, three-dimensional look. For the alphabet letters, try using a different color for each letter to make the page pop. A rainbow pattern works great here. Warm colors like red, orange, and yellow can alternate with cool colors like blue and purple. If there are small decorative details on or near the letters, use contrasting colors to make them stand out. Fill in any background space with soft, light colors like sky blue or pale yellow so the dinosaur and letters remain the main focus. Use colored pencils or fine-tip markers for the small letter details to keep lines neat and clean.
Coloring challenges: Which parts are difficult to color and need attention for Dinosaur Learning ABC coloring page?
• Alphabet Letter Spacing: The letters of the alphabet are arranged around the dinosaur, which means the coloring space within and around each letter can be very small and closely packed. Staying inside the lines without accidentally coloring over the letter outlines or nearby illustrations takes a steady hand and careful attention, especially for younger children who are still developing fine motor control.\n\n• Consistent Color Variety for 26 Letters: Choosing and applying a different color to each of the 26 letters is a fun challenge, but it requires planning ahead. Without a color plan, kids might run out of their favorite colors or accidentally repeat colors too close together. Mapping out a color scheme before starting helps keep the page balanced and visually appealing.\n\n• Dinosaur Body Shading: The dinosaur's body likely has curves, limbs, a tail, and possibly scales or texture markings. Coloring these areas smoothly while showing depth and dimension is tricky. Blending two shades of the same color, or adding a darker tone along edges and under body parts, requires patience and some coloring skill.\n\n• Small Decorative Details: If the letters or surrounding areas include tiny illustrations or decorative accents, these are among the hardest parts to color precisely. Fine-tip tools like colored pencils or thin markers are needed to fill these small spaces without bleeding into adjacent areas.\n\n• Overall Color Harmony: With so many individual elements on the page, keeping all the colors working together without the image looking too chaotic is a real artistic challenge. Balancing bold letter colors with a softer dinosaur tone and a light background takes thoughtful color coordination.
